Hi,

ich try to use a FTP Connection and got the following error.

While i got an result ->

FTPDir( servername, "user", "password", "Offene_Posten//Data//*.*", x )
MessageBox x

i allways recieve the error message: "The Server has returned an extended error ... File Server not avaible"

while executing:

FTPPutFile( servername, "user", "password", "I:\\oao1\\sft\\ftp_schuelbe\\hagebau\\edifact\\prod\\test.txt", "//Offene_Posten//Data//" )

Someone, who can help?

Thanks
Dominik

This means that the specified server is not responding. Is the value in servername variable valid?

I execute the both commands (FTPDir, FTPPutFile) in the same script, I use the same Servername, User, Password.

FTPDir is working fine (showing me the directory) ... but FTPPutFile results into this error. The Server is ready, otherwise even the FTPDir would'nt work.

I:\\oao1\\sft\\ftp_schuelbe\\hagebau\\edifact\\prod\\test.tx -- this looks very suspicious. Standard FTP servers rarely absolute directory names when referring to files. File references are usually relative and starting with the root folder for the user being logged in. Also it is unlikely your FTP server allows you to access network shares, I assume "I:\oao1" refers to a mapped network drive.
